Fantastic Location! Enjoy a cozy, updated, and bright home in a family-friendly neighborhood. Ready to move in hardwood floors across the main and second levels, neutral decor, and Working condition appliances on the main floor. The finished basement adds extra space, and has potential for separate in law suite. Large private yard, Land scaped. Pond with Water Feature, abancence of ever changing flowers. Plum, cherry raspberry and black berry bushes. Low maintain garden with many annual flowers and plants. Shed has hear with wood stove. Ideal for growing families or investors. Conveniently located near public tennis courts, a short walk from Pine Point Pool, Hockey arena, and playground , and close to all amenities including plazas, Walmart and Costco minutes highways, TTC, parks, and schools. Minutes to highway 401 and 400. Go station/ Pearson airport and Humber hospital nearby.

Who lives here?

The Elms, Toronto is a west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, salespeople and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, and Spanish speakers.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of babies, kids aged 5 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24 and adults aged 50 to 64.
